Fortune Chantraprapawat's Journey from Bangkok Architecture to New York Experiential Design

architecture-design · 2026-04-20

Fortune Chantraprapawat, also known as Chayanidh Chantraprapawat, serves as the Creative Designer at My Beautiful City USA, a firm that crafts immersive experiences for high-end brands such as Nike, Jacquemus, Victoria Beckham Beauty, and Reformation. With an architectural education from Bangkok, she has previously worked at Architects 49 Limited and NITAPROW, and interned at the Thailand Development Research Institute. Fortune earned her Master of Science in Advanced Architectural Design from Columbia University, where her project on sustainable futures for the USPS was recognized as a top 30 finalist in the Global Design Graduate Show. She has also worked on production design for New York Fashion Week and contributed to a Lincoln Center dance production, promoting sustainable design practices and viewing AI as a partner in creativity.
